Understanding Solar Brokers: Your Guide to Renewable Energy Savings
Solar energy is becoming increasingly popular as homeowners strive ways to lower their environmental footprint and save money on electricity bills. With the rise in solar adoption, a new position has emerged: the solar broker. Many homeowners may find themselves uncertain about what a solar broker actually does, and how they can assist.
Solar brokers act as representatives between solar broker services homeowners interested solar installations and experienced solar contractors. They function by evaluating different solar solutions on the market, choosing the best fit for your needs, and negotiating competitive pricing with reputable solar installers.
- Check out are some key perks of working with a solar broker:
- They save you time and hassle by handling the entire procedure from start to finish.
- Customers receive access to a wider range of solar products than you would be able to locate on your own.
- Solar brokers present expert guidance based on your energy demand and budget.
- They bargains favorable pricing and financing conditions on your behalf.
By harnessing the expertise of a solar broker, you can guarantee that you make an informed decision about your solar project, and optimize your savings potential.

Venturing Into Solar Broker vs. Installer: Choosing the Right Partner for Your Project
Investing in solar energy is a significant decision, and selecting the right professional can make all the difference. While both solar brokers and installers play a role to your project, they handle it in unique ways. A solar broker acts as your guide, navigating various solar options and connecting you with reputable installers. Conversely, a solar installer focuses on the hands-on aspects of installing your solar system.
To make an savvy choice, evaluate your preferences. Value most finding the best deal? A broker can be your champion, sourcing competitive quotes and bargaining terms on your behalf. If you prefer a more personalized approach, an installer might be a better fit. They can provide comprehensive system designs, handle all the setup, and offer ongoing support. Ultimately, the optimal choice depends on your individual project goals.
